摘要
A new clamping resonant dc-link inverter was proposed to improve the efficiency and reduce the auxiliary resonant circuit loss. With no coupled inductors in the auxiliary circuit, it could bring convenience to analyze and calculate the circuit. Because of the clamping circuit, the maximum voltage across the dc-link inverter devices was maintained at around 1.01-1.1 times of the input source voltage. When all main switches in the inverter needed operating, the dc-bus voltage decreased to zero via the single switch which controlling the resonance of the auxiliary circuit. Then the main switching devices in the inverter were operated under zero-voltage condition and auxiliary switching device was turned on under zero-current condition and turned off under zero-voltage condition. The operation principle was analyzed based on the equivalent circuits at different operation modes. The conditions of soft-switching and the process of parameter design were also achieved. A 10kW laboratory prototype was built. The experimental results demonstrated that all main switching devices realized soft-switching. Therefore, the novel clamping resonant dc-link inverter can effectively reduce switching loss and improve efficiency. © 2016 Chin. Soc. for Elec. Eng.
